Appropriate Preposition:

  • Acquit of ( খালাস দেওয়া ) High court acquit him of the charge.
  • Listen to ( শোনা ) Listen to the news on the radio.
  • Relevant to ( প্রাসঙ্গিক ) Your remark is not relevant to the point.
  • Dedicate to ( উৎসর্গ করা ) This book is dedicated to his father.
  • Crave for ( আকাঙ্খা করা ) He craves for wealth.
  • Prohibit from ( বারণ করা ) I prohibited him from going there.

Idioms:

  • vile sycophant ( খঁয়ের খা )
  • Cats and dogs ( মূষল ধারে ) It was raining cats and dogs.
  • Carry the day ( জয়লাভ করা ) Rajib, the best player of the school, carried the day in the annual sports.
  • As usual ( যথারীতি ) He is late as usual.
  • At a low ebb ( নিম্নমুখী ) His fame is at a low ebb now.
  • Out of doors ( বাহিরে ) It is rather cold out of doors.

Bangla to English Expressions (Translations):

  • সব কেমন চলছে? - How is everything?
  • আমার ক্ষুধা নেই - I have a poor appetite
  • আসুন কথা বলি - Let’s talk
  • হয় ইহা গ্রহণ কর নয় বর্জন কর - Either take it or leave it
  • এই লাইনটি মুছে ফেল, ভাবমুর্তি ক্ষুন্ন কর না। - Erase this line, don’t tarnish the images.
  • তুমি এলেই হল - It will be quite enough if you come
